I wouldn't call Contrary Leaf Storm "nothing". Serperior is one of the best Grass-types in the game for a reason. Can't say the same about Seviper and being a Poison-type.

And for someone putting such a heavy emphasis on stats determining your winner, I'm surprised you're in favour of Seviper; Seviper is both slow AND frail, which is not a good combination to have. At least Serperior has amazing Speed and decent bulk - its Sp.Atk soon picks up after a Contrary Leaf Storm, which isn't hard to get from pretty much any Water-type. Seviper is stuck with bad Speed and bulk, all it can really do is tango with things slower it can deal definitely beat, because faster Pokemon can usually either outright kill it or cripple it to the point where it's not going to do anything else. It might have decent offenses and movepool but what does that matter when the majority of the time it's not going to get to use them well enough?
